The discussion at this event considered how progressives can respond to the challenge of Iran. The seminar sought to consider the possibilities of engagement with the government of Iran over the nuclear issue, regional security and trade co-operation. It also examined government human rights abuses and ways in which progressives in Britain could build a 'dialogue of civilisations' with reformers in Iran.
